Transaction ddc76247d0a0a631c8c94d9295f392311364d140f3158d424b884a05a86db718
1 Input
1 Output
-
ddc76247d0a0a631c8c94d9295f392311364d140f3158d424b884a05a86db718:0
- value
- 35118782
- script pubkey
- OP_0 OP_PUSHBYTES_20 27291bd924d6b53f22e052a6df17dbb1cd220e6a
- address
- bc1qyu53hkfy666n7ghq22nd797mk8xjyrn2cltayc